Neural basis of protracted developmental changes in visuo-spatial working memory

H Kwon1, A L Reiss, V Menon

  • 1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ences, Program in Neuroscience, and Stanford Brain Research Center, Stanford University School of Medicine, Stanford, CA 94305, USA.

Summary

Visuo-spatial working memory (VSWM) improves into young adulthood, supported by developing fronto-parietal brain networks. This study reveals concurrent maturation of spatial attention and verbal memory systems in the brain.
